What is Digital Fleet Management?
Digital fleet management refers to the use of technology to manage and optimize the operation of a company's fleet of vehicles and equipment. This includes the use of telematics, GPS tracking, cloud storage, and data analytics to monitor and analyze fleet performance, maintenance needs, and asset utilization.

Features of Digital Fleet Management Tools
Digital fleet management tools offer a range of features that enable companies to manage their fleets more effectively:
1. GPS Tracking: Real-time location tracking of fleet assets, enabling managers to monitor asset movement and optimize routes.
2. Telematics: Sensors that collect data on vehicle performance, fuel consumption, and driver behavior, providing insights for optimization and maintenance.
3. Cloud Storage: Secure, centralized storage of fleet data, accessible from anywhere with an internet connection.
4. Data Analytics: Advanced analytics tools that process fleet data to identify trends, predict maintenance needs, and optimize performance.
5. Mobile Apps: Mobile applications that allow fleet managers and drivers to access fleet data and communicate in real-time.
Overcoming Challenges in Digital Fleet Management
While digital fleet management offers numerous benefits, companies may face challenges when implementing these tools:
1. Integration with Legacy Systems: Integrating digital fleet management tools with existing systems and processes can be complex and time-consuming.
2. Data Security: Ensuring the security of sensitive fleet data stored in the cloud is crucial to prevent unauthorized access and breaches.
3. Employee Adoption: Getting employees to embrace and effectively use digital tools can be challenging, requiring training and change management efforts.
